Why does everyone seem one deep breath away from burnout? The Anxious Tribe explores the rising tide of collective anxiety in a hyper-connected, overstimulated world. You’re not the only one doom-scrolling at midnight. You’re not alone in your spirals. This book maps the emotional terrain of our times—showing how fear, urgency, and overstimulation have become the norm. But it also points to a way out. Through awareness, boundaries, and nervous system repair, you’ll learn how to rejoin the world without letting it flood you. This isn’t self-help. It’s survival. For all of us.

Tess Mori is a cultural anthropologist and writer who focuses on the intersection of psychology, society, and belonging. With a doctorate from the University of Toronto, Mori has spent years researching how communities respond to fear and uncertainty. Her work has appeared in academic journals and mainstream publications, where she brings anthropological insight to contemporary issues. She has taught courses on identity and culture, and her lectures are known for blending research with real-world storytelling. The Anxious Tribe is her debut book for general readers. Mori lives in Toronto and works across North America as a researcher and speaker.
